Reading The Shining. This book will be living in the freezer for a while. It's not scary, but it has a good bit of creepiness with it. I don't think I'll have the guts to watch the movie. I enjoy how it's very believable all the interactions are (i.e. Jack losing his mind slowly). I was bothered slightly by how quickly things were tied up at the end of the book. Certain things could have been explained more or made more believable though. My biggest finding of this was Jack's losing his mind completely at the end. All of a sudden, he went from hearing voices like the rest of his family to getting drunk and talking to images in the past that easily convinced him to kill his wife and son.
